Web5 mei 2024 · 3. Operational Acceptance Testing (OAT) Operational acceptance testing (OAT) focuses on both the functional and non-functional requirements of a system. These can be related to the product’s functional stability, reliability, and operational readiness. Examples of OAT can be disaster recovery, maintenance, and security procedures. Web31 okt. 2014 · The prime objective of security testing is to find out how vulnerable a system may be and to determine whether its data and resources are protected from potential intruders.
